gpt4 book ai didi

c# - 基类如何从 Global.asax 调用 Session_End 方法?

转载 作者:行者123 更新时间:2023-12-02 04:54:34 26 4
gpt4 key购买 nike

我想在用户 session 过期后将用户重定向到登录页面。我创建了一个基页,每个 aspx 代码隐藏文件都将继承该基页。

我真正想知道的是,一旦 Session_End() 方法在 session 超时时被调用,您如何设置 basepage 方法自动执行重定向?

我已经在 Google 上搜索了一个多小时来寻找解决方案,但仍然没有找到。

我以前从未使用过 global.asax 页面,这是我第一次创建基页,所以任何建议或解释都将非常感谢

最佳答案

我认为这是不可能的,因为当 Session_End 被触发时,用户长时间处于非事件状态并且可能连接已经关闭。

您需要做的是在所有页面中运行某种 javascript 计时器,它会在超时时重定向用户。

亲切的问候,

埃德温。

关于c# - 基类如何从 Global.asax 调用 Session_End 方法?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18229023/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com